A: There's no strict age limit, but they recommend at least 8 years old for the hike to keep up with the group and enjoy the experience. My 10-year-old loved it and had no issues! Just keep in mind the terrain varies, so be prepared for some ups and downs.
A: Definitely dress in layers! The weather can change quickly on the mountain. Wear comfortable shoes for hiking, and bring a rain jacket just in case. They provide warm clothing if you need it, which is super helpful. I went in early spring, and it was chilly but beautiful!
A: Yes, you can reschedule! Just make sure to give them a call or send an email at least 48 hours in advance. They’re pretty flexible as long as you notify them in time. We had to shift our date last minute, and they were super accommodating!
